uPVC friction hinges

UPVC windows are now an increasingly popular choice for homeowners due to their energy-efficiency and durability. However they need a certain amount of maintenance to ensure their performance. The hinges are one of the most crucial elements of a window hinge repairs since they provide the structural support to keep the window open. There are various kinds of uPVC friction hinges that are available, and each has distinct advantages and disadvantages.

UPVC friction hinges are constructed using high-quality steel, which is a durable and strong metal that can withstand a great amount of pressure. These hinges are also coated with a special coating that protects them from corrosion and gives them longevity. The coating is applied to the hinge during the manufacturing process and provides additional protection against damage and wear.

There are many types of uPVC hinges that are made for different environments and applications. Some hinges are of a material called hot-rolled, which is made when billets or ingots are heated to temperatures that are higher than their recrystallization temperature. This process improves the ductility of the material and makes it less likely to break or crack during normal usage.

Other uPVC sliding friction hinges are able to be hidden from view to give them an elegant and sleek appearance. These hinges can be used with uPVC casement and side-opening uPVC window. Concealed uPVC sliding friction hinges are available in a variety of sizes to fit various window sizes.

The detent friction uPVC hinge holds the opening in place, preventing it from springing forward. These hinges are typically used on windows with sash, and they are available in a variety sizes and finishes. They are often paired up with an incline mechanism to make them easier to operate. They can be adjusted to offer different levels of friction. This lets you control the opening and closing of your sash windows, and also protect them from accidental closure in high winds. Similarly, restricted friction stay hinges restrict windows from moving to a set location, and are often used in schools, hospitals as well as commercial buildings to increase security.

Surface-mounted uPVC hinges

uPVC windows have revolutionized the construction industry, offering durability and energy efficiency. Their smooth operation is dependent on crucial components like hinges. Selecting hinges of high-quality will ensure that your doors and windows work properly, while preserving their structural integrity.

There are a variety of hinges to pick from, whether you want to upgrade your uPVC doors or replace the hinges on your windows. These non-mortise uPVC hinges are easy and quick to install. They are available in a variety of sizes, styles and finishes. They are extremely adaptable and permit you to modify your doors and windows.

The uPVC Pivotica Pro is designed for surface-mounted installations and offers a sleek design which is a perfect match with the frame profile. They are a great option for homes with minimalist design. These hinges also feature an active closing damper to prevent the door from swinging too far out and hitting the wall. They are also much easier to operate than traditional pivot hinges which could snag on the floor or ceiling.

Another type of uPVC surface-mounted hinge is the geared continuous hinge, that is designed to withstand the most demanding environments. These hinges have interlocking gears and are encased inside a protective cap. They are durable and resistant to wear due to their design.

These uPVC swing hinges can be used to achieve an opening angle of 180 degrees. This is important for some applications, like doors with multiple hinges that require to open wider than other kinds of uPVC hinges. They are also ideal for applications that require a large amount of torque, such as frames and doors made of steel.

The uPVC hinges come in a variety of sizes and finishes, making them suitable for all types of doors and frames. They are also lightweight and can be installed quickly. They work with a wide range of frame and door systems like uPVC and aluminum. Their versatility and easy installation process make them a smart option for any renovation.
